What is Talking Stick?
Talking Stick was the original name of the project during the planning phase
Talking Stick was a method of management used by some Native American tribes during discussions.
Whoever held the "talking stick" was listened to and responsible for passing on the talking stick. . .

What are the goals?
* Easily install to USB, Zip or hard drive media.
* Booting from CD (or DVD), the CD drive is then free for other purposes.
* Booting from CD (or DVD), save everything back to the CD.
* Booting from USB Flash drive, minimise writes to extend the life indefinitely.
* Extremely friendly for Linux newbies.
* Boot up and run extraordinarily fast.
* Have all the applications needed for daily use.
* Will just work, no hassles.
* Will breathe new life into old PCs
* Load and run totally in RAM for diskless thin stations
